Lifeguard Training Class – The American Red Cross Lifeguard Training Class prepares students for work as professional lifeguards. Students are required to pass a swimming test on the first day of class and must be 15 years old by the completion of the class. Students who successfully complete the course are certified in Lifeguarding, CPR for the Professional Rescuer, AED and First Aid. Employment opportunities are available for qualified applicants.

Pool Closures Due To Weather

Carpenter Park Recreation Center Opens New Indoor Pool ...

Upon seeing lightning or hearing thunder, the pool must be cleared immediately. Outdoor aquatic site staff and patrons are to stay away from objects that conduct electricity, such as reaching poles and umbrellas and are to stay a minimum of 30 metres away from any wire fence. Patrons may return to the water 30 minutes after the last sound of thunder or the last sight of lightning. For further information regarding the potential danger of lightening strikes, contact Environment Canada.

Lap Swimming

  • To best utilize our lane space, please follow the below guidelines for lap swimming.; Lap lanes are on a first come, first serve basis.
  • Avoid resting in the center of the lane or at the center of the wall.;
  • Avoid using wide strokes or back strokes unless you can swim in a straight line.
  • Be considerate of others and communicate with your lane buddy and the lifeguards, as appropriate.

These policies will be enforced inside the Aquatic Center as well.
